ACTIVE NOT RECRUITING

NCT03079999

Study of Aspirin in Patients With Vestibular Schwannoma

This is a phase II prospective, randomized, double-blind, longitudinal study evaluating whether the administration of aspirin can delay or slow tumor growth and maintain or improve hearing in VS patients.

ACTIVE NOT RECRUITING

NCT01199978

Hearing Outcomes Using Fractionated Proton Radiation Therapy for Vestibular Schwannoma

In this research study we are looking at another type of radiation called proton radiation which is known to spare surrounding normal tissues from radiation. The proton radiation will be delivered using fractionated stereotactic radiotherapy (FSRT) to improve localization of the small tumor target. Proton radiation delivers minimal radiation beyond the area of the tumor. This may reduce side effects that patients would normally experience with conventional radiation therapy. In this research study, we are looking to determine the effects of fractionated proton radiotherapy on long-term hearing preservation and controlling tumor growth.
